Pijul does both. It's a VCS, that is a CRDT, that preserves conflicts until a human resolves them. Look it up: https://pijul.org. - Source: Hacker News / 5 months ago

React Native is a widely used framework for hybrid mobile app development, supported by Meta. It enables developers to build cross-platform applications using JavaScript and React while delivering a near-native experience. Instead of relying on WebViews, React Native renders actual native UI components, resulting in better performance and smoother interactions. - Source: dev.to / 8 months ago
